Runbook — Opaline Schema Registry basics

Welcome to the team. The Opaline registry is the source of truth for every event schema flowing through the Drossel message bus. Before changing anything, understand that producers fail closed: if the registry is unreachable, publishing stops cluster-wide. Always check replica health and the compatibility-mode setting before restarts, and never delete a subject without a sign-off from the platform lead. For reference during incidents, the service's current configuration values appear directly below.

config for tagep-yajef:
ulawyn:
  log_level: error
  metrics_host: metrics.ulawyn.lumiclabs.internal
  pin: 0564
  pool_size: 32

Briefing: Q3 Cash-Flow Forecast — Ostermann Fabrics. Operating inflows are projected at 6% above Q2, supported by earlier collections from the Bryndale wholesale accounts. Outflows rise modestly due to loom maintenance at the Ferrow Mill and prepaid dye contracts. Net position remains positive through the quarter, with a temporary dip in week nine. No covenant concerns. Finance team should refresh assumptions fortnightly. The confidential note on forward business plans is set out below.

internal memo for yahag-tahog: The pricing group signed off on a budget of $152.8 million for Project Soriel.

Following the mid-year review, the Tarnwick Group executive committee has approved a 22% reduction to the regional marketing budget. Sponsorships and print campaigns in the Ostermere district are discontinued immediately; digital spend continues at reduced levels. Branch managers must reallocate remaining funds toward retention campaigns for the Lumira product line and submit revised plans within ten working days. The confidential rationale from the planning office appears directly below.

board note of baweg-bawig: Project Tamath slips by six weeks because of the audit delay.